This position is a maintenance crew member responsible for maintenance and repair of plant equipment at a plant, which includes areas of expertise in electrical, mechanical repair and instrumentation.Primary goal is to assure safe and efficient production by responding to changing conditions in a timely manner. Emphasis will be preventive maintenance and plant repairs.
- Performs maintenance in all areas of the plant on a scheduled or emergency basis:
- Electrical repairs on motors, motor starters; running conduit and pulling wires for new installations
- Building repairs and cleaning
- Moves, sets, calibrates, as needed, controls such as knobs, valves, switches, levers, and index arms, on control panels to control process variables such as flows, temperatures, pressures, vacuum, time, and chemicals, by automatic regulation and remote control of processing units, such as heaters, coolers, compressors, exchangers, and other units.
- Determines malfunctioning units by observing control instruments, such as meters and gauges or by automatic warning signals, such as lights and sounding of horns.
- Inspects equipment to determine location and nature of malfunction such as leaks, breakages and faulty valves.
- Communicates directly with production to coordinate maintenance and repair work.
- Patrols units to verify safe and efficient operating conditions.
- Performs preventive maintenance activities as required.
- Assists with new installations and other projects, as requested by the supervisor.
- Works with contractors to plan and implement installation of new equipment or systems.
- Participates in safety, health, and environmental programs.
- Participates in programs and procedures required to ensure plant cleanliness.
- Other duties as assigned by supervisor/manager.
